Published May 2010 by Dark Horse.
This item is not in stock at MyComicShop. If you use the "Add to want list" tab to add this issue to your want list, we will email you when it becomes available.
1st printing. Collects Four Color (1942-1962 Series 2) #375, 437, and 488.
Written by Paul S. Newman. Art and cover by Jesse Marsh.
In 1947, Jesse Marsh - an artist who would inspire generations of comics creators and earn the esteem of professional peers such as industry legends Russ Manning and Alex Toth - won over millions of readers with his four-color vision of Edgar Rice Burroughs' beloved character Tarzan. To the delight of his readers, Marsh would continue to draw Tarzan comics for the following nineteen years. But his passion for Burroughs' creations wasn't limited to the legendary writer's jungle lord, and in the early 1950s he teamed up with prolific comics writer Paul S. Newman to breathe life into another of Burroughs' beloved heroes: the courageous adventurer John Carter of Mars!
Edgar Rice Burroughs' John Carter of Mars: The Jesse Marsh Years reprints all three issues of Dell's Four Color Comics: John Carter of Mars series in their entirety and is sure to delight fans of science fiction and Golden Age comics alike!
Hardcover, 240 pages, full color.

Published Dec 2010 by Dark Horse.
This item is not in stock at MyComicShop. If you use the "Add to want list" tab to add this issue to your want list, we will email you when it becomes available.
1st printing. Collects material from Tarzan (1972-1977 DC) #207-209 and Weird Worlds (1972-1974 DC) #1-7. Written by Marv Wolfman. Art by Howard Chaykin, Murphy Anderson, Gray Morrow, Sal Amendola, and Joe Orlando. Since his serialized debut in All-Story magazine in 1912, the spacefaring adventurer John Carter of Mars has become one of Edgar Rice Burroughs' most beloved characters. The star of decades worth of novels and comic books, he's soon to be immortalized on the silver screen as well, in the upcoming Walt Disney Pictures major film release John Carter of Mars! In this volume, John Carter, an ex-soldier turned prospector, is transported to Mars-"Barsoom," as it is known to its natives-under mysterious circumstances, and becomes a champion dedicated to protecting his new home and newly found love, the princess Dejah Thoris, from warring alien civilizations and a host of deadly Barsoomian beasts! Featuring the work of comics legends Marv Wolfman, Murphy Anderson, Gray Morrow, Sal Amendola, Joe Orlando, and Howard Chaykin! Softcover, 112 pages, full color. Cover price $14.99.

Published Jul 2019 by Edgar Rice Burroughs, Inc.
This item is not in stock at MyComicShop. If you use the "Add to want list" tab to add this issue to your want list, we will email you when it becomes available.
1st printing.
Written by Edgar Rice Burroughs.J. Allen St John. Cover by Bob Eggleton.
The very best yet in this amazing series of lavishly illustrated editions, filled with fine artwork and bonus features. This is one of two editions designed as they would have been published in the 1930s or 40s by ERB Inc. and Grosset & Dunlap, right down to the binding cloth and embossed title logos. Each book has a different binding, different front/end matter, different dust jackets by Bob Eggleton and Douglas Klauba. Inside are 20 color illustrated plates including 12 newly colorized plates of art by Reed Crandall and J. Allen St. John and 90 b&w illustrations.
Slipcase and dust jacket signed by artists Doug Klauba and Bob Eggleton and by Richard Lupoff (Introduction) & Kevin J. Anderson (Foreword).
Hardcover (with Slipcase), 6-in. x 8-in., 336 pages, Text (with full color and B&W Chapter Illustrations).
NOTE: Limited to 60 copies.

Tags: 35 Cent Variant, Price Variant
This item is not in stock at MyComicShop. If you use the "Add to want list" tab to add this issue to your want list, we will email you when it becomes available.
Limited Distribution 35 Cent Price Variant. Based on Edgar Rice Burroughs' Martian novels, John Carter Warlord of Mars ran for 28 issues. "Air Pirates of Mars, Part 1" finds John Carter rescuing Dejah Thoris from an army of Tharks and uncovering a plot to destroy his beloved Barsoom. Includes Welcome Back, Carter text editorial. Script by Marv Wolfman, pencils by Gil Kane, inks by Dave Cockrum. Cover by Kane and Cockrum. Cover price $0.35.
